A pen is sold for Rs. 120 at a profit of Rs. 20. What was the cost price?
ARs. 140
BRs. 110
CRs. 100
DRs. 130
✓ Correct Answer: C — Rs. 100
CP = SP - Profit = 120 - 20 = 100.
